Some of the main courses include:

  1. 4-Hour Basic Driver Improvement to avoid points on your license

  2. 8-Hour Intermediate Driver Improvement for repeat or more serious violations

  3. 12-Hour Advanced Driver Improvement for court-required cases or multiple tickets

  4. Mature Driver Course for drivers over 55 who want insurance discounts

  5. First-Time Driver Courses for new drivers preparing for their permit or license test.

  6. DUI Programs Level I and II for drivers ordered by the court or DMV

DUI Programs

Metro Traffic School provides state-approved DUI programs. These programs are required by the court or DMV for certain drivers. Level I programs cover first-time offenses. Level II programs cover repeat or more serious offenses.

Students complete class hours and a one-hour evaluation. After finishing, Metro issues a Proof of Enrollment. This proof helps drivers apply for hardship licenses if needed. The classes teach about alcohol and drug risks. They also explain legal consequences and safe driving habits.

Bilingual instruction and multiple locations make DUI programs easy to access. Students can complete classes without major disruption to their schedule.
